Wynton Marsalis
In this unique DVD, Wynton traces the history of the Trumpet from the early examples of a Conch Shell and Ram’s Horn, to today’s modern orchestral and jazz instruments. He explains how the construction of the Trumpet has changed over time, and demonstrates those changes by playing and talking about different historical instruments and their respective historical eras. In addition to this entertaining and interesting historical review, Wynton includes two bonus sections specifically for the trumpet player and musician. "Essential Tips for Getting Your Sound", and "From The Beginning", give the player unique insight from this excellent educator, Pulitzer Prize Winner, and superb musician to bring into your own sound every day ! MASTER CLASS – JAZZ, contains Wynton working with a college jazz quintet. Includes in-depth discussions and demonstrations of all all aspects of the rhythm section as well as the front line horns. Also covers concepts of improvisation as well as playing in a group. Techniques of listening and interacting as a group are demonstrated and discussed. Cram packed with useful information for players and teachers who work with small groups and big bands. All serious jazz students and teachers should study this outstanding and informative DVD!
